Odhiambo Washington writes:
> May I kindly request for help with running faxgetty everytime the computer
> boots up. I need it for faxing service with Hylafax but I am dumb on that point.
> I need it to be ALWAYS on ;-)

Put the startup script in /usr/local/etc/rc.d, make sure it ends in
".sh" and is executable.

If you installed it from the ports, their may be a hylafax.sh.sample
there already.
